I played Halflings for two years under the 3rd Edition rules. They don't need the Big Guy ogre...the treemen are good enough. What they need is the Chef. I won about 50% of my games. That's right...50%. It was exclusively due to the chef sucking away team re-rolls from the opponent and providing my team more to use. If the chef was lost or rolled poorly...the game followed suit. I'm a huge advocate for making the chef the head coach of the team.
